Today our ‘Song To Chew’ is BE GENTLE ROBIN from my “Wha’D’Ya Wanna Do?”album, written by Dr. Tedd Judd, a concerned Dad who gives advice to his young son Robin.  I love this song because it shows that if we want our children to be gentle, the best way to do that, is for us to model ‘gentleness’ for them.  I got spanked as a child, but I’ve never hit my kids.  I believe that hitting a child teaches them that violence is an acceptable way to solve a problem, and with armed conflict currently happening in numerous places around the globe, and the threat of nuclear warfare still a possibility, it makes sense to teach our children other options for resolving conflicts.  If we refuse to see violence as a solution to our problems, they will learn from us, and search for other ways to resolve difficulties.  We need to honor the fact that each of us have our own path, even our own children.  It’s all about our own ability to be ‘gentle’.  Thanks for stopping bye!~ Please subscribe to my Songs To Chew podcast = https://podcasts.apple.com/us/podcast/peter-alsops-songs-to-chew/id1446179156~ CAMPING WITH DADS = https://www.amazon.com/Camping-Dads-Peter-Alsop/dp/B08CS871QW/ref=sr_1_1~ www.FaceBook.com/WeLikePeterAlsop~ www.Youtube.com/peteralsop = videos~ www.Patreon.com/peteralsop = support my music & other artistic endeavors~ www.peteralsop.com/music  = CDs & downloads Get full access to Peter Alsop’s Substack at peteralsop.substack.com/subscribe
